Course contents
In the laboratory, students will acquire skills related to education for sustainability and education in nature, through the deepening of the natural dimension, as an educational and privileged context of learning and development experiences, so that they become a resource for boys and girls for the construction of a competnte look. The theoretical insights will be included in the educational framework of services for children, through planning of educational paths within the network of services for children.
